Glenn Beck Blasts Manifest Destiny as 'Really, Really Evil' (VIDEO)

by Jeremy Taylor, posted Aug 19th 2010 12:25PM
Because he is from Washington state, and generally a big fan of the whole American greatness thing, you'd think Glenn Beck would be all about Manifest Destiny.

But no. On Wednesday's 'The Glenn Beck Program' (weekdays, 5PM ET on Fox News) Beck blasted Manifest Destiny, the 19th century theory that encouraged our still forming nation to expand out to the Pacific.

After declaring Manifest Destiny "really, really evil," Beck delivered a little sermon:

"Manifest Destiny is a perversion of Divine Providence. When a man tries to live in accordance with nature's god and nature's law and works for the betterment of man, God helps. However, when man seeks power and riches by using nature's god or nature's laws in conjunctions with others seeking the same -- power and riches -- God withdraws and evil masquerades as good."

Wednesday's show was the first of Beck's three-part series on race in America, "The good, the bad and the ugly." So tune in Thursday and Friday if you want to get more provocative contrarianism, Beck-style.
